TTI is the sum of all applicable, enabled signal scores, normalized to a 0–100 scale, then multiplied by a KEV exposure factor. The denominator adjusts to your vertical and configuration — so tools are never penalized for signals that don't apply to their market.
The CISA Known Exploited Vulnerabilities catalog is special. A tool with an active, unpatched KEV entry cannot be made trustworthy by stacking other credentials. KEV is applied as a final multiplier — capable of zeroing the score regardless of what comes before it.

TTI does not track software versions. Without version data, we cannot assert that a KEV entry doesn't apply to your specific environment — so once a product appears in KEV, that flag stays. Partial credit is awarded only for vendor patch publication, never for assumed customer remediation.
KEV is the one signal that cannot be disabled. Not by you, not by a partner, not by configuration. This is intentional liability protection.
Each signal contributes points to the additive score. Maximum contributions vary by signal and by vertical. Signals not applicable to your vertical are excluded from both the numerator and denominator — no penalty for missing what was never relevant.
Each analyst firm scores independently — no single firm can dominate. Per-firm contribution is capped, with a multi-year time decay applied to reduce the weight of stale evaluations. Stacking multiple years from the same firm is not permitted.
Combined contribution across all three firms is capped.
A procurement gate signal — "has this product been vetted for government use?" — not a threat signal. RAMP scores are multiplied by a vertical weight: full weight for Federal, State/Local Gov, DIB, K-12 and Higher Ed; reduced for less-relevant verticals.
Independently tested cryptographic implementations. Technically rigorous across most verticals — any environment handling sensitive data benefits from confirmed cryptographic validation.
Cloud-specific security assurance from the Cloud Security Alliance. Level 2 (independent third-party assessment) carries significantly more weight than Level 1 (self-assessment), reflecting the rigor difference between attested and verified claims.
Each vertical has a default signal profile reflecting which credentials matter in that market. You can enable additional signals within your vertical's bounds — but you cannot disable KEV, and you cannot enable signals that aren't applicable. Both rules are platform-defined for score consistency.

The exact point values, decay schedule, and KEV multipliers are confidential — but they are cryptographically committed. We publish a SHA-256 fingerprint of every versioned signal schedule. Customers and auditors who receive the schedule under confidentiality can hash it and confirm it matches this public commitment, proving the scoring was fixed in advance and never retro-tuned to favor a vendor.
The final 0–100 score maps to one of six bands. Each band determines how the tool is surfaced — or whether it's surfaced at all.
| Range | Band | Recommendation Behavior |
|---|---|---|
| 85 – 100 | Highly Trusted | Recommend with confidence. Surface prominently. |
| 65 – 84 | Trusted | Recommend. Minor caveats may apply. |
| 40 – 64 | Provisionally Trusted | Recommend with conditions. Surface applicable caveats. |
| 20 – 39 | Low Trust | Surface but flag prominently. Advise additional due diligence. |
| 1 – 19 | Insufficient Vetting | Do not recommend without disclosure. |
| 0 | Do Not Recommend | KEV hit with no patch available. Suppress from recommendations. |

TTI reflects vendor-level trust signals available from authoritative public registries at the time of catalog enrichment. It is not a vulnerability scanner, patch verification engine, or real-time threat feed.
Where we cannot verify something — such as whether a published vendor patch has actually been applied in your environment — we say so explicitly rather than imply confidence we don't have.
Every signal traces back to a specific public registry: a KEV entry, a FedRAMP Marketplace listing, a CMVP certificate ID, a CSA STAR registry record, an analyst report citation.
Each score snapshot is preserved per assessment for audit and historical comparison — supporting procurement justifications, board reporting, and grant applications.
Signal data refreshes on cadences calibrated to each source: KEV weekly (with manual force-refresh for active incidents), RAMP / FIPS / CSA monthly. Analyst rankings refresh quarterly via the catalog enrichment pipeline.
Every refresh is recorded as a versioned snapshot, so changes in a tool's TTI score are traceable over time.
